Scope and content
The sum of £10 18s 0d paid to J Goode & Sons for painting done in the Lodge, Staircases and Courts plus Sundries between 30th October 1839 and 5th September 1840, paid on 5 December 1840.
LODGE
30th October 1839 = Jobs to kitchen chimney piece
9th November 1839= Best bedroom: 12 light sashes and frames, 60 ft of bars
9th July 1840 = Entrance gates to lodge, both sides, door in the wall, door to lodge in best Brunswick Green 37 yds
1st August 1840 = Scullery painted over stove 34 yds, 36 ft of skirting, light sash and frames (both sides), Coal bar stool in green, 5 Hearths in white
STAIRCASES
3rd April: Mr Dick's staircases fast painted, grained & varnished 34 yds, Door to room cleaned & varnished 4 yds, 20 squares grained, & varnished, rubbing down. Letter to staircase. 25 ft of skirting. Light sash and frame.
COURTS
9th July
SUNDRIES
5th September= Porter Lodge in 1.5 inch letters, light sash and frame.
Pump in back yard painted 3 times- lead.
